theyve been on a while i spoke to a guy who works in a wheels place on wheelwhores and he was telling me this is how it will of happened different brands do it worse than others main cause is the profile being so low you cant tell when the pressure is a bit low it may look inflated but only have 10 psi so therefore munches the wall to bits, and the stretch putting strain on the wall and getting constantly twatted by potholes etc etc,

im going to go from 215 to 225/35/19 to take a bit of stress off the walls and run pirelli p zeros as there stronger than federal shite
